I would like to consider this the first official review for Juicy Cheesy Burger. This burger joint that opened up less than two-months ago in Newport RI is setting the bar. Previously unseen , a non-chain restaurant that highlights the burger is a welcome addition to the Newport area.
I ordered the Cheeseburger Large Meal. 1/3-1/2lb burger with american cheese a side of fries and a can of pop.

I enjoyed my experience here. My visit was late on a Saturday in the Newport off-season. Inside the restaurant was fairly quiet, but I knew I was going to like this place as soon as we entered. The tables and chairs look cool and there was a nice bright menu hanging above the register manned by the man I assume to be the owner. We were greeted with enthusiasm. During and after the ordering process, the owner was open to conversation and let us know a little about the young establishment and possibility to expand up to Providence.
The burgers are not cooked to order, they are all made medium-well to well done, but don’t let that detour you from going here. The highlights of this already good meal were the homemade bun and delicious fries. I enjoyed every bite of this meal.
I would go here again if I were down in the Newport area. I hope enough people stop by this restaurant to keep in business through the winter months and help it survive until the tourist season when I am sure Juicy Cheesy Burger will flourish. And who knows, maybe we will see one in Providence soon if people show this place enough love.
